Condividi tramite


Metodo ICLRAppDomainResourceMonitor::GetCurrentAllocated

Ottiene la dimensione totale in byte di tutte le allocazioni di memoria fatte dal dominio di applicazione da quando è stato creato, senza sottrarre la memoria che è stata sottoposta a procedure di Garbage Collection.

HRESULT GetCurrentAllocated([in]  DWORD dwAppDomainId,
                            [out] ULONGLONG* pBytesAllocated);

Parametri

  • dwAppDomainId
    [in] ID del dominio di applicazione richiesto.

  • pBytesAllocated
    [out] Puntatore alla dimensione complessiva di tutte le allocazioni di memoria.

Valore restituito

Questo metodo restituisce gli HRESULT specifici seguenti nonché gli errori HRESULT che indicano l'esito negativo del metodo.

HRESULT

Oggetto di descrizione

S_OK

Il metodo è stato eseguito correttamente.

COR_E_APPDOMAINUNLOADED

Il dominio di applicazione è stato scaricato o non esiste.

Note

Questo metodo è l'equivalente non gestito della proprietà AppDomain.MonitoringTotalAllocatedMemorySize gestita.

Requisiti

Piattaforme: vedere Requisiti di sistema di .NET Framework.

Intestazione: MetaHost.h

Libreria: inclusa come risorsa in MSCorEE.dll

Versioni di .NET Framework: 4

Vedere anche

Riferimenti

Interfaccia ICLRAppDomainResourceMonitor

Concetti

Monitoraggio delle risorse del dominio applicazione

Altre risorse

Interfacce di hosting

Hosting (riferimenti alle API non gestite)